.footer[data-v-ebe177b6]{overflow:hidden;padding-top:var(--48);position:relative}@media (max-width:1025px){.footer[data-v-ebe177b6]{padding-bottom:48px}}.footer__bg[data-v-ebe177b6]{background:var(--gradient);top:0;right:0;bottom:0;left:0;position:absolute;transform:rotate(180deg)}@media (max-width:1025px){.footer__bg[data-v-ebe177b6]{display:none}}.footer__line[data-v-ebe177b6]{background:var(--color-black);height:.0694444444vw;left:0;position:absolute;top:0;width:100%}@media (max-width:1025px){.footer__line[data-v-ebe177b6]{display:none}}.footer__wrap[data-v-ebe177b6]{position:relative;z-index:1}.footer__nav-link[data-v-ebe177b6]:not(:last-child){margin-bottom:.6944444444vw}@media (max-width:1025px){.footer__nav-link[data-v-ebe177b6]:not(:last-child){margin-bottom:10px}}.footer__nav-1[data-v-ebe177b6]{margin-bottom:.6944444444vw}@media (max-width:1025px){.footer__nav-1[data-v-ebe177b6]{margin-bottom:10px}}.footer__typer[data-v-ebe177b6]{margin-top:auto;position:relative}@media (max-width:1025px){.footer__typer[data-v-ebe177b6]{display:none}}.footer__typer-wrap[data-v-ebe177b6]{bottom:0;left:0;position:absolute}.footer__soc-coma[data-v-ebe177b6]{font-size:1.6666666667vw;margin-right:.3472222222vw}@media (max-width:1025px){.footer__soc-coma[data-v-ebe177b6]{font-size:24px;margin-right:5px}}.footer__head-col[data-v-ebe177b6]{display:flex;flex-direction:column;justify-content:space-between}@media (max-width:1025px){.footer__head-col[data-v-ebe177b6]{flex:0 0 50%}}.footer__head-col[data-v-ebe177b6]:first-child{flex:0 0 24.7222222222vw}@media (max-width:1025px){.footer__head-col[data-v-ebe177b6]:first-child{flex:0 0 50%;order:1}}.footer__head-col[data-v-ebe177b6]:nth-child(2){flex:0 0 24.7222222222vw}@media (max-width:1025px){.footer__head-col[data-v-ebe177b6]:nth-child(2){flex:0 0 50%;order:2}.footer__head-col[data-v-ebe177b6]:nth-child(3){display:none;order:4}}.footer__head-col[data-v-ebe177b6]:nth-child(4){flex:0 0 24.2857142857rem;margin-left:auto}@media (max-width:1025px){.footer__head-col[data-v-ebe177b6]:nth-child(4){flex:0 0 100%;margin-left:0;margin-top:48px;order:7}}.footer__head[data-v-ebe177b6]{display:flex}@media (max-width:1025px){.footer__head[data-v-ebe177b6]{flex-wrap:wrap;padding-top:48px}.career-page .footer__head[data-v-ebe177b6]{padding-top:0}}.footer__nav-3-mob[data-v-ebe177b6]{display:none}@media (max-width:1025px){.footer__nav-3-mob[data-v-ebe177b6]{display:block}}.footer__work-together-text[data-v-ebe177b6]{font-size:1.6666666667vw}@media (max-width:1025px){.footer__work-together-text[data-v-ebe177b6]{font-size:22px}}.footer__soc[data-v-ebe177b6]{display:flex;flex-wrap:wrap}.footer__soc-mob[data-v-ebe177b6]{display:none}.footer__foot[data-v-ebe177b6]{display:flex;justify-content:center;margin-top:var(--48)}@media (max-width:1025px){.footer__foot[data-v-ebe177b6]{display:none}}.footer .svg-logo[data-v-ebe177b6]{flex:0 0 98.9583333333vw;width:98.9583333333vw}@media (max-width:1025px){.footer .svg-logo[data-v-ebe177b6]{flex:0 0 93.75vw;width:93.75vw}}.footer__nav-3[data-v-ebe177b6]{margin-bottom:.6944444444vw}@media (max-width:1025px){.footer__nav-3[data-v-ebe177b6]{margin-bottom:0}}.footer__showreel[data-v-ebe177b6]{margin-top:4.0277777778vw}@media (max-width:1025px){.footer__showreel[data-v-ebe177b6]{display:none}}.footer__showreel-link[data-v-ebe177b6]{display:flex;gap:.3472222222vw}@media (max-width:1025px){.footer__showreel-link[data-v-ebe177b6]{gap:5px}.footer__copyright[data-v-ebe177b6]{display:none}}.about-page .footer__line[data-v-ebe177b6],.footer__head-col-mob[data-v-ebe177b6],.projects-page .footer__line[data-v-ebe177b6],.service-page .footer__line[data-v-ebe177b6],.services-page .footer__line[data-v-ebe177b6]{display:none}@media (max-width:1025px){.footer__head-col-mob[data-v-ebe177b6]{display:block;flex:0 0 50%;margin-top:48px;order:5}}.footer__head-col2-mob[data-v-ebe177b6]{display:none}@media (max-width:1025px){.footer__head-col2-mob[data-v-ebe177b6]{display:block;flex:0 0 50%;margin-top:48px;order:6}}.footer__head-col-mob .footer__showreel[data-v-ebe177b6]{display:block;margin-top:0}.footer__nav-link-sub[data-v-ebe177b6]{bottom:.8333333333vw;left:100%;margin-left:.2083333333vw;position:absolute}@media (max-width:1025px){.footer__nav-link-sub[data-v-ebe177b6]{bottom:14px;margin-left:-13px}}.footer__nav-link-wrap[data-v-ebe177b6]{display:inline;position:relative}
